North American PCB Industry Shipments Up 20.7 Percent in July
The Global Electronics Association announced today the July 2025 findings from its North American Printed Circuit Board (PCB) Statistical Program. The book-to-bill ratio stands at 1.00.
North American EMS Industry Shipments Down 4.1 Percent in July
The Global Electronics Association announced today the July 2025 findings from its North American Electronics Manufacturing Services (EMS) Statistical Program. The book-to-bill ratio stands at 1.23.

Global Electronics Industry Remains Under Pressure from Rising Costs
The global electronics manufacturing supply chain remains under pressure from rising costs, with 61% of firms reporting higher material costs and 54% noting increased labor expenses. according to the Global Electronics Association’s Sentiment of the Global Electronics Manufacturing Supply Chain Report.
